Last week Piston Cloud Computing released Piston Enterprise OS, also known as PentOS, a complete, end-to-end solution for building private OpenStack compute and storage clouds. The OS brings together OpenStack features with a hardened and secure custom-built LinuxOS and its Null-Tier Architecture meant to support massive cloud environments. The company also announced a collaboration with Dell, so PentOS is now certified to run on popular Dell servers and switches. CEO and co-founder Joshua McKenty put together this video demonstration showing how simple it is to configure, install and deploy a PentOS cloud.
